We had a wonderful holiday at Sandy Beach Resort. The beach and lagoon are outstanding. The coral is beautiful with an abundance of fish and sea life all within easy swimming distance from the resort. This was the best snorkeling experience we have ever had and we have been to many locations around the world. The resort is run by a great team headed by a couple who are passionate about ensuring their guests have the best possible holiday.
Sandy Beach has a restaurant which provided a cooked breakfast and dinner. The food was superb - quite a different experience than other places we have stayed in the islands. The beach cafe at Matafonua lodge (just a short stroll away) also offered cooked or continental breakfast and a great choice of lunch options.
We have booked next year for the whale season and highly recommend Sandy Beach as a fantastic holiday option.
